Content: Construction is officially underway on the new $320 million medical tower at W. 38th St. in Austin, Texas. The facility, expected to be completed in 2025, will include neonatal intensive care units, C-section suites, a dedicated OB-GYN emergency department, teaching and learning center, areas for minimally invasive gynecologic surgeries, and an expanded antepartum space. Located on the south side of the Ascension Seton Medical Center campus, this new tower is expected to revolutionize the way medical care is provided in the Central Texas area.
